Udupi: Replace Dr B R Ambedkar statue placed in front of ZP – Mallajamma

Spread the love

Udupi: Mallajamma, the Chairperson of Dr B R Ambedkar Development Corporation Ltd, has instructed the district administration to replace the statue of Dr B R Ambedkar erected in front of the Zilla Panchayat. Her instructions were received during the review meeting of Dr B R Ambedkar Development Corporation and an interaction programme with leaders of the Dalit community organised at the Dr V S Acharya Memorial Auditorium, Zilla Panchayat Rajathardri, Manipal here, on July 16.

Vijayalasksmi, a resident of Brahmavar, said that the face of the statue of Dr B R Ambedkar installed in front of the ZP in Udupi did not match Dr Ambedkar’s face. She said that it was neglected by the district administration amid repeated suggestions from the Dalit community leaders. Mallajamma instructed the Social Welfare Department Deputy Director for action into the issue as it was associated with the sentiments of the Dalit community. Kumar KAS, Additional Deputy Commissioner, said that the report has been sent to the government and action will be initiated at the earliest.

Sunder Master said that the corporation has to focus on the unemployed youth of the Dalit community by introducing skill development programmes and promoting entrepreneurial development. The youth are actively involved in fishing activities and if financial assistance was provided to them to buy fishing boats and nets, it would ameliorate their lives. He urged the corporation to extend loans for buying boats and fishing nets. Mallajamma said that skill development programmes will be given to the youth in Mangaluru and Mysusu.

“Middlemen were solely responsible for the government projects not reaching out to the poor and marginalised,” said Sundari Puttur. She urged Mallajamma to dissolve the Member of Legislative Assembly committee for selecting the beneficiaries and instead to formulate a committee under the leadership of the district officer of Dr B R Ambedkar Development Corporation.

Uday Kumar Tallur said that there was a need to increase subsidy to schemes like Ganga Kalyan Yojana since to dig an open well cost Rs 5 Lakh. Vijaylaksmhi said that illegal activities were reported in Ambedkar Bhavan near the old RTO office; Mallajamma instructed the CMC Commissioner to take necessary action in this regard. Sunder Master urged for the construction of dormitories to promote tourism and employment opportunities through the corporation in the district.

Later, addressing a press meet Mallajamma said that the government in its budget has allotted Rs 16,000 crores to the Social Welfare Department which is first among other states in India. The government has released Rs 450 crores for formulating programmes for the development of the Dalit community. She also said that the corporation would need Rs 2,500 crores to reach out to the beneficiaries at large.

She also said that the Tahasildar has been instructed to thoroughly check applications while processing for caste certificates. Certificates are being issued to people who are not Dalits in Udupi, Dakshina Kannada and Karwar districts. A proposal has been sent to the government to provide Innova cars rather than Tata Indigo cars to Dalit youth to promote tourism, she added.

Prior to the interaction programme, the website of Dr B R Ambedkar Development Corporation, Udupi was launched by Mallajamma.

Annamalai K, District Superintendent of Police; B C Geetha, President of Malenadu Development Board; Veronica Cornelio, President of Karnataka Soaps and Detergents Ltd; Yuvraj P, President of City Municipality Council and others were present.
